Fusion of time of arrival and time difference of arrival for ultra-wideband indoor localization
Abstract
This article presents a new approach for the wireless clock synchronization of Decawave ultra-wideband transceivers based on the time difference of arrival. The presented techniques combine the time-of-arrival and time-difference-of-arrival measurements without losing the advantages of each approach. The precision and accuracy of the distances measured by the Decawave devices depends on three effects: signal power, clock drift, and uncertainty in the hardware delay. This article shows how all three effects may be compensated with both measurement techniques.
